Data Engineer

The Data Engineer is central to building our future-state architecture by modernizing how public health data moves, transforms, and informs decision-making at scale. You will lead the design and implementation of next-generation pipelines, ensure data reliability and compliance, and guide integration teams through migration from legacy systems. 


As part of a collaborative, agile team, you’ll work closely with data architects, integration engineers, data scientists, and product stakeholders to deliver solutions that directly impact public health outcomes. The ideal candidate thrives in complex data environments, is motivated by meaningful mission-driven work, and brings both technical depth and mentorship skills to elevate our interoperability platform. 


What You’ll Be Doing
  • Play a key role in shaping the future of our data interoperability platform. 
  • Design and operatesecure, high-performance data pipelines for real-time and batch public health data flows. 
  • Architect and implement scalable solutions that move sensitive health data reliably and meet strict security and compliance standards. 
  • Build and optimizeETL/ELT pipelines using NiFi, Kafka, Python, and SQL. 
  • Collaborate with interoperability, product, and data science teams to migrate legacy pipelines to modern architectures. 
  • Fine-tunedata lakes and ensure smooth data exchange across systems. 
  • Define monitoring and alerting strategies and create runbooks to support operational teams. 
  • Troubleshoot production issues to maintainstable and performant pipelines. 
  • Drive continuous improvement across the data ecosystem through collaboration, innovation, and strong execution. 
  • Contribute directly to building and delivering high-quality, scalable integrations that drive rapid product progress. 
  • Collaborate closely with teammates to share knowledge and ensure smooth, efficient development workflows. 


What We're Looking For
  •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Data Engineering, Information Systems, or a related field  
  • A minimum of 3 years of experience implementing enterprise-grade data pipelines OR 7 years of equivalent professional experience implementing enterprise-grade data pipelines 
  • Someone who thrives at the intersection of technical complexity and mission-driven impact. 
  • Proven ability to build robust, production-grade pipelines from the ground up and work confidently with distributed data systems. 
  • A curious, proactive problem solver who excels in fast-paced, agile environments. 
  • Hands-on expertise with NiFi, Kafka, Python, and SQL, including designing, operating, and optimizingETL/ELT pipelines in the cloud. 
  • Experience using or integrating with OpenSearch/Elasticsearch. 
  • Familiarity with CI/CD and DevOps practices; able to partner with DevOps/SRE to integrate pipelines into existing tooling (not responsible for platform design). 
  • Practical experience using relational databases and existing schemas (implementing against established data models; extending under guidance). 
  • Strong understanding of data security and compliance requirements for sensitive data. 
  • Excellent cross-functional collaborator with clear communication and strong technical documentation skills. 
  • A growth mindset with a passion for solving complex interoperability challenges elegantly and efficiently. 
  • Strong communication skills to translate complex engineering concepts into clear strategies for cross-functional partners.


What Would Make You Stand Out
  • Deep technical expertise paired with a strong understanding of public health data environments. 
  • Experience with healthcare data standards such as HL7 v2.x, FHIR, and terminologies like LOINC, CVX, SNOMED, and ICD-10. 
  • Proven success building event-driven architectures with Kafka or implementing data de-identification strategies. 
  • Hands-on experience with integration engines (e.g., Rhapsody, Mirth) and containerized deployments (e.g., Docker, Kubernetes). 
  • Demonstrated ability to scale data platforms in production environments. 
  • Familiarity with Master Patient Index (MPI) solutions or data deduplication frameworks. 
  • Bring a proactive mindset—anticipating challenges, designing with scalability and security in mind, and delivering solutions that accelerate time to product.

About InductiveHealth: InductiveHealth (www.inductivehealth.com) was co-founded by Matthew Dollacker and Stephen Macauley in 2013.  Today, InductiveHealth is headquartered in Atlanta, Georgia and has over 80 team members across the United States supporting state, tribal, local, and territorial (STLT) public health agencies in addition to Federal agencies such as the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C).  In early 2021, InductiveHealth became the exclusive commercial partner of Johns Hopkins University Applied Physics Laboratory (JHU/APL) for the Electronic Surveillance System for the Early Notification of Community-based Epidemics (ESSENCE) syndromic surveillance solution.  To accelerate growth in the wake of the COVID-19 pandemic, InductiveHealth become a portfolio company of Diversis Capital (https://www.diversis.com/) in early 2022.
